Document management AI applies machine learning to automate the organization, classification, retention, and retrieval of enterprise documents. These systems address the challenge of managing vast document repositories where manual filing and classification cannot keep pace with document creation.\n\nAI classification models automatically categorize documents by type, department, project, and sensitivity level as they enter the system. NLP extracts key metadata including dates, parties, amounts, and topics from document content. Automated workflows route documents to appropriate reviewers, apply retention policies, and enforce access controls based on content classification.\n\nIntelligent document search goes beyond filename and metadata matching to enable full-content semantic search across the document repository. AI helps organizations comply with information governance requirements by automatically identifying documents subject to legal holds, retention schedules, and privacy regulations.
